CMOs Unscripted is the podcast where top marketing leaders ditch the talking points and get real. Hosted by veteran tech broadcaster Lisa Martin, each episode dives into candid, off-the-record conversations with the world’s most innovative CMOs—from startups to Fortune 500s. Expect bold stories, hard-won lessons, and unfiltered insights on brand strategy, AI, data, customer experience, and the ever-evolving role of the CMO. What happens when a widely recognized B2B technology company realizes its name no longer represents its future?
In this episode of CMOs Unscripted, Lisa Martin speaks with Lynn Lucas, CMO of Everpure, formerly Pure Storage, about what it took to rename and reposition a billion-dollar public company without losing the brand equity, customer trust, and market recognition it had spent years building.
Lynn explains why the company’s transformation was much bigger than a new logo, visual refresh, or marketing exercise. As the business expanded from storage into enterprise data management, the company needed a brand capable of reaching new executive buyers while preserving the trust and equity it had already earned.
Beyond the name itself, Lisa and Lynn examine the enormous operational effort required to launch a new brand across a public company. More than 100 people across the company eventually became involved, including teams responsible for employee communications, legal, IT, finance, sales enablement, partner programs, digital marketing, and investor-related activities.
